Abstract
COMPOSIÇÕES DE EMULSçO ANTIESPUMANTE PARA APLICAÇÕES DE MOAGEM DE POLPA. Uma emulsão de óleo em água útil como um antiespumante pa- ra aplicações de moagem de polpa e papel é descrita, O antiespumante tem uma mistura de óleo (de um óleo de triglicerideo ou uma mistura de óleos de triglicerídeos e silicone), um agente de estabilização (para produzir a mistura de óleo estável na emulsão), partículas de sílica hidrofóbicas, tensoativos, dispersantes e outros componentes. A emulsão é utilizável diretamente em baixas concentrações para controlar espuma.
